Xsport On Paper - Samplings of Published Practices from the Global South Archive who linked up with scientistsVisiting Peru, Mexico, Brazil, Thailand, Malaysia, Singapore, Indonesia, and Taiwan; interviewing artists, revolutionaries, NGOs, independent publishers, independent libraries, historians, and designers. This book is a compilation of 18 case studies on publishing practices by Chang Wen hsuan between 2018 and 2020 while visiting the global south and meeting practitioners from diverse backgrounds.
